We wanted to stay somewhere close to town in Grants Pass since we planned to ride the Jet Boats and that is located in the middle of downtown. But we couldn't find any place that would handle our rig and also wasn't a postage stamp on the asphalt. So we tried a place on the advice of a friend who lives in the area. Indian Marys is a county park located on the Rogue River about 25 minutes from the town of Grants Pass. It is a wonderful park and we had full hook-ups with 50 amp power. The only problem was that we once again wound up with no cell service! That is why this post is a day late.
